"Maurice Soudan : “still Life With Cake”"
Maurice Soudan (1878-1948): “Still life with cake”, oil on panel 44 x 52 cm mounted in a beautiful silver Art-Deco frame with tiers 58 x 65 cm. Signed Mce Soudan, dirty varnish, small accidents on the frame. This beautiful Belgian artist went into exile in Toulouse during the First World War where he left pivotal works between the Fauves and the Symbolists imbued with poetry. A retrospective was organized at the Musée des Augustins in 1960. This painting with its rigorous composition is revealed by Maurice Soudan's deliberately simplified touch on an everyday subject in a very Art-Deco aesthetic close to that of the Basque Ramiro Arrue.
